How to digitize a logo from a photo into an editable SVG
Turn a logo photographed on a menu, sign, package, shirt, or old print into clean flat artwork, a transparent image, and an editable SVG.
Quick answer
To digitize a logo from a photo, first isolate the intended mark from the photographed surface, correct perspective and lighting, rebuild it as flat artwork, remove the background, and then convert the clean result into vector paths. Photo tracing and logo reconstruction are different
A normal raster trace follows visible color boundaries. In a photo, those boundaries include paper texture, shadows, glare, folds, camera angle, and compression. Reconstructing the logo first gives the vectorizer a much clearer source.
| Source problem | What should happen | What should not become vector art |
|---|---|---|
| Angled menu photo | Correct the logo proportions | Preserve the camera perspective |
| Paper texture | Recover flat brand colors | Trace every fiber and shadow |
| Uneven lighting | Normalize light and dark regions | Create extra gradient shapes |
| Busy background | Isolate the complete mark | Include the table or wall |
| Small lettering | Rebuild readable letterforms | Trace pixel noise as typography |
Prepare a photo that contains enough evidence
Photograph the complete logo at the highest practical resolution. Keep the camera parallel to the surface, avoid glare, and make sure no finger, fold, or object covers the artwork. A second straight-on photo is often more useful than aggressive enhancement of one poor image.
Crop around the logo but leave a small margin. Do not crop off punctuation, registered marks, thin borders, or small taglines that may belong to the identity. If the brand has an official website or PDF, compare the reconstruction with that reference before approving it.
Review the reconstructed mark before vectorizing
Check the silhouette, letter spacing, negative spaces, repeated corner radii, circles, and brand colors. The result should look like artwork designed on a flat canvas—not like a cleaned photograph.
After reconstruction, background removal should produce a transparent raster with no white rectangle or colored halo. Vectorization can then create editable shapes with fewer accidental paths.
Validate the SVG
Open the final file in a vector editor and select individual regions. Confirm that the logo consists of paths rather than one embedded photo. Test it on white, dark, and checkerboard backgrounds and at both small and large sizes.
Use this checklist:
- The original proportions are preserved.
- Letter counters and thin gaps remain open.
- Flat colors match an approved reference.
- No paper, wall, fabric, glare, or shadow remains.
- The SVG contains editable geometry.
- A transparent PNG is kept as a compatibility export.
Frequently asked questions
Can any photographed logo be recovered?
No. Covered elements and unreadable text cannot be reconstructed with certainty. Better photos or official references reduce guessing.
Is this the same as converting a PNG to SVG?
Not quite. A clean PNG can be vectorized directly. A real-world photo normally needs visual reconstruction before tracing.
